Let me start by saying, I'm not a big fan of coffee. It's okay, but because I don't enjoy it much, I don't usually go to cafes. I think I've walked by this one a dozen times but today I actually went in and am now kicking myself for having not gone in earlier. While I can't speak to the quality of coffee seeing as I didn't try it, there are so many other things if you are a non coffee drinker like myself, mainly really good smoothies, which are stupidly hard to find. They also had a surprisingly large variety of pastries, lunch items, and ice-cream! I ordered a salmon bagel for about $11, and it was the fattest piece of salmon I've seen squished between two parmesan bagel slices (they also have a pretty good variety of bagels, which I wasn't expecting) and it was so good. A similar sized piece of salmon in other restaurants would probably run for about 20, and this salmon bagel sandwich was bigger than most burgers I've eaten. It was absolutely delicious and worth every penny. I am definitely going to have to bring my friends there the next time we are walking around downtown, 10/10 recommend

Several friends all recommended I check Cups out for lunch. It was suggested I try the Ring of Fire bagel for lunch. Not saying it was life changing, but it was amazing. It is a jalapeño bagel with Turkey, Bacon lettuce, tomato, and avocado. The chips that accompanied it were nice and crispy kettle fried style. They were super friendly and I expect I will be dropping in again to check out other things on the menu that stood out to me. Especially the leftover turkey sandwich or whatever they call it (the name is in purple on the blackboard so I couldn't read that part) I do know it has cream cheese, turkey, stuffing and cranberries on it. Wish I had my camera with me to take a photo of the Ring of Fire as it was just as beautiful as it tasted.
